The first component: Eagon


Introducing Eagon, a mysterious fellow claiming to be Zana's brother, gave us a lot of interesting angles to explore Zana's mission from. Like us veteran Exiles, he knows a lot about Zana and feels a connection to her, yet she is essentially a stranger to him. He believes that she simply must have all the answers to his burning questions about his heritage... and yet life is never so simple. He has spent his life trying to uncover and realize who he is and perhaps, why he is.

Working towards unraveling who Eagon is and helping him try to piece things together makes him quite relatable as a person. Despite his rather pompous sense of entitlement (we are all flawed), he just wants to understand who he is, his place in the world and to save who he believes to be his sister.

The second component: Zana


Interestingly for this expansion, Zana doesn't exactly occupy screen-time a great deal. It is what she has created that we are able to explore, and trying to understand why she has done so is what drives the story forward. Eagon discovers that Zana has been experimenting with the Atlas and manifesting memories, and even ideas, into reality. But why?

We are able to see what has mattered most to her, in the very areas we traverse and the figures we fight. In many ways, this exposure to Zana is more effective than even talking to her directly. Her memory threads are split into 3 groups of paired themes, based on Loneliness and Neglect, Trauma and Fear, and Reverence and Dread.

Loneliness and Neglect


This is first touched on by encountering a form of Sirus at a time unfamiliar to us, exploring the deeper part of their connection and her regrets with what became of a relationship she neglected.

Once we defeat this part of the thread, we can enter the 'Moment of Loneliness' where we witness Zana as a child, trying and failing, to get her father's attention. This moment then transforms into the 'Incarnation of Neglect', where a permutation of her father is presented as a monstrous creation that we must overcome on her behalf.


Trauma and Fear


These themes are explored by her residual trauma from the Templars and how they treated her and her father, exemplified by the fight with the Cardinal of Fear.

This allows us entry into the 'Moment of Trauma' where we witness young Zana making her father quite cross. This moment then becomes the 'Incarnation of Fear', a frightening imagining of someone her father never truly was.


Reverence and Dread


This theme is shown in the form of Innocence, a God, taking the main stage as a revered but deceitful figure - yet another whose promises are to be broken. This thread line shows that even with good intentions, the grip of power can subvert even divine motivations.

After beating this form of Innocence, we can enter the 'Moment of Reverence' where we witness child Zana watching her father deliver a speech in Oriath. This moment is then reshaped into the 'Incarnation of Dread', showing just how much her fathers notoriety and influence affected her.

Australians to face age checks from search engines


Australians using search engines while logged in to accounts from the likes of Google and Microsoft will have their age checked by the end of 2025, under a new online safety code co-developed by technology companies and registered by the eSafety Commissioner.

Search engines operating in Australia will need to implement age assurance technologies for logged-in users in "no later than six months”, under new rules published on Monday.

While only logged-in users will be required to have their age checked, many Australians typically surf the web while logged into accounts from Google, which dominates Australia’s search market and also runs Gmail and YouTube; and Microsoft, which runs the Bing search engine and email platform Outlook.

If a search engine’s age assurance systems believe a signed-in user is “likely to be an Australian child” under the age of 18, they will need to set safety tools such as “safe search” functions at their highest setting by default to filter out pornography and high impact violence, including in advertising.

Currently, Australians must be at least 13 years of age to manage their own Google or Microsoft account.

Stop Killing Games is an European Citizens Initiative aiming to keep games playable even after their developers and publishers have stopped supporting it.

To get the initiative onto the EUs agenda so it has the chance to become EU law, it has to both reach 1 million signatures total and minimum thresholds in at least 7 countries. Now both of those goals have been reached.

XPipe - A connection hub for all your servers: Status update for the v16 release


Today I can share a major development status update of XPipe, a connection hub that allows you to access your entire server infrastructure from your local desktop. It can make your life easier when working with any kind of servers by eliminating all the commonly tedious tasks that come up when interacting with remote systems, either from the terminal or from a graphical interface. XPipe comes with integrations for SSH, docker and other containers, various hypervisors, and more without requiring setup on your remote systems. You can also keep using your favourite text/code editors, terminals, password managers, shells, command-line tools, and more with it.

Hub

Docker compose


This release introduces support for docker compose. Containers in compose projects are grouped together and can be managed all at the same time via compose project entries.

The container state information shown is also improved, always showing the container state in combination with the system information.

Compose

Batch mode


There is now a batch mode available that allows you to select multiple systems via checkboxes and perform actions for the entire batch. This can include starting/stopping, automatically adding available subconnections, or running scripts on all selected systems.

You can toggle the batch mode in the top left corner.

Batch

Password managers


The password manager integrations have been upgraded:
- There is now support for KeePassXC
- All password manager integrations have been reworked to work out of the box without configuration
- There is now support to use password manager SSH agents more easily
- You can now unlock the xpipe vault with your password manager

Password Manager

Terminals


The terminal integration comes with many new features:
- There is now built-in support for the terminal multiplexers tmux, zellij, and screen. This is especially useful for terminals without tabbing support.
- There is also now built-in support for custom prompts with starship, oh-my-posh, and oh-my-zsh.
- On Windows, you now have the ability to use a WSL distribution as the terminal environment, allowing you to use the new terminal multiplexer integration seamlessly on Windows systems as well.

SSH


Various improvements were made to the SSH implementation:
- The SSH gateway implementation has been reworked so that you can now use local SSH keys and other identities for connections with gateways
- The VSCode SSH remote integration has been reworked to allow more connections it to be opened in vscode. It now supports essentially all simple SSH connections, custom SSH connections, SSH config connections, and VM SSH connections. This support includes gateways
- There is now built-in support to refresh an SSO openpubkey with the opkssh tool when needed
- There is now the option to enable verbose ssh output to diagnose connection issues better
- For VMs, you can now choose to not use the hypervisor host as SSH gateway and instead directly connect to the VM IP

Other


  • Connection names, e.g. VM names, will now automatically update on refresh when they were changed
  • You can now launch custom scripts within XPipe with a command output dialog window without having to open a terminal
  • Various installation types like the linux apt/rpm repository and homebrew installations now support automatic updates as well
  • The k8s integration will now automatically add all namespaces for the current context when searching for connections
  • The application window will now hide any unnecessary sidebars when being resized to a small width. This makes it much easier to use XPipe in a tiling window arrangement
  • The webtop has been updated to have terminal multiplexers, proper konsole tab support, disabled kwallet, and more
  • Various error messages and connection creation dialogs now contain a help link to the documentation sections


A note on the open-source model


Since it has come up a few times, in addition to the note in the git repository, I would like to clarify that XPipe is not fully FOSS software. The core that you can find on GitHub is Apache 2.0 licensed, but the distribution you download ships with closed-source extensions. There's also a licensing system in place with limitations on what kind of systems you can connect to in the community edition as I am trying to make a living out of this. I understand that this is a deal-breaker for some, so I wanted to give a heads-up.

An analysis of 15M+ biomedical abstracts from 2010 to 2024 finds researchers using AI to write abstracts use certain words far more often than those who don't


Large language models (LLMs) like ChatGPT can generate and revise text with human-level performance. These models come with clear limitations, can produce inaccurate information, and reinforce existing biases. Yet, many scientists use them for their scholarly writing. But how widespread is such LLM usage in the academic literature? To answer this question for the field of biomedical research, we present an unbiased, large-scale approach: We study vocabulary changes in more than 15 million biomedical abstracts from 2010 to 2024 indexed by PubMed and show how the appearance of LLMs led to an abrupt increase in the frequency of certain style words. This excess word analysis suggests that at least 13.5% of 2024 abstracts were processed with LLMs. This lower bound differed across disciplines, countries, and journals, reaching 40% for some subcorpora. We show that LLMs have had an unprecedented impact on scientific writing in biomedical research, surpassing the effect of major world events such as the COVID pandemic.

Un oggetto di un altro sistema solare è venuto a farci visita


È probabilmente una cometa ed è solo la terza osservazione di questo tipo di qualcosa che ha avuto origine altrove

Un oggetto interstellare, cioè proveniente da un sistema solare diverso dal nostro, si sta dirigendo a grandissima velocità verso la Terra, ma non c’è nessun pericolo di impatto con il nostro pianeta. Dalle osservazioni svolte finora sembra che sia una cometa ed è stata chiamata 3I/ATLAS: è il terzo oggetto in viaggio tra sistemi solari diversi a essere stato mai notato nelle nostre vicinanze da quando puntiamo i telescopi verso il cielo. Nei prossimi mesi sarà studiato dagli astronomi, per approfondire le nostre conoscenze su come alcuni oggetti si mettano a vagare tra diversi sistemi solari all’interno della Via Lattea, la nostra galassia.

Nel sistema solare in cui ci troviamo si stima ci siano milioni di asteroidi e comete in orbita intorno al Sole, ma è raro che siano osservati corpi celesti provenienti da altrove, sia perché sono piccoli sia perché spesso rimangono a grande distanza da noi. Un telescopio in Cile, che fa parte di ATLAS, l’iniziativa della NASA per osservare i corpi celesti e capire se alcuni potrebbero scontrarsi con la Terra, aveva osservato per la prima volta un nuovo oggetto martedì 1 luglio, e inizialmente sembrava fosse un asteroide. Successive osservazioni avevano permesso di scoprire un’orbita insolita del corpo da poco osservato, portando alla conclusione che si trattasse con molta probabilità di qualcosa proveniente da un altro sistema solare.

Spesso sono necessarie alcune settimane prima di farsi un’idea dell’orbita di un oggetto di questo tipo, ma grazie a un astrofilo – cioè un appassionato che aveva controllato alcune osservazioni svolte da ATLAS a fine giugno – è stato possibile affinare da subito i calcoli, capendo meglio la traiettoria del nuovo corpo celeste. La notizia è circolata velocemente tra gli astronomi e gli appassionati di astronomia e negli ultimi giorni le decine di osservazioni fatte con vari telescopi in giro per il mondo hanno permesso di confermare, con un buon margine di certezza, che il misterioso oggetto è una cometa: cioè un corpo fatto per lo più di ghiaccio e di alcuni frammenti rocciosi (gli asteroidi sono invece per lo più rocciosi).

Armed Attack Against the Autonomous Purépecha Community of Cherán K’eri


Since the early morning of July 2, 2025, the community of Cherán K’eri has been under armed attack by unknown subjects seeking to enter the areas of Rancho del Pino and Cerrito del Aire. In response, our Community Round (autonomous security force established by our system of self-government) has resisted the aggression, activating the barricades to protect the population. At the moment, one person has been reported killed and another injured, both members of the Community Round. This fact fills us with indignation, sadness, and rage.

This attack is not an isolated act. It is part of an escalation of violence that has intensified in the state of Michoacán, where organized crime fights over territory with total impunity, seriously affecting rural and Indigenous communities. In recent weeks, the aggressions have intensified in different regions of the state, including the Purépecha Plateau, where communities like Nahuatzen, Arantepacua, Capácuaro, and Santa Fe de la Laguna have also been the target of threats, armed incursions, and territorial dispossession.
